Connect-Pinba为Node.js框架集成实时监控中间件
Connect-Pinba 是一个专为 Node.js 框架设计的中间件工具,能够高效地将性能数据自动发送至 Pinba 服务器。Pinba 是一个基于 MySQL 的存储引擎,负责实时监控和统计数据分析,支持 MySQL 作为只读接口。借助 Connect-Pinba,用户可以轻松在应用程序中嵌入自动化数据收集功能。
安装
可以通过 npm 安装 Connect-Pinba 中间件模块:
$ npm install connect-pinba
用法
在使用 Connect-Pinba 时,该中间件需在程序启动后首先被调用:
const connect_pinba = require('connect-pinba');
const connect = require('connect');
const server = connect.createServer(connect_pinba({ schema: 'http', server: 'YOUR_PINBA_SERVER' }));
通过上面的代码,您可以将应用程序的性能数据无缝传递到 Pinba 服务器,用于实时监控和优化性能。
connect-pinba-master.zip
预估大小:11个文件
connect-pinba-master
文件夹
.travis.yml
448B
.jshintignore
25B
package.json
893B
test
文件夹
test.js
1KB
test-server.js
467B
LICENSE
1KB
README.markdown
2KB
.gitignore
39B
6.05KB
文件大小:
评论区